Purpose/Objectives of Event
Purpose of the symposium is three-fold:

• Provide updates to ongoing research studies and to provide results of completed studies.
• Provide a forum for discussion about future research questions and projects
• Prioritize research questions
• Introduce PACE System


Rationale

CREATE advocates responsive research by university faculty that will benefit public school stakeholders. We are committed to keeping public schools informed about research that directly affects them as well as soliciting information about their research needs.
